שאלון פרטים אישיים + ניסיון + קו"ח
לאחר מכן במידה והשאלון עובר סינון מקבלים מבחן בית שאורך שעה
בשלב הבא מזומנים לראיון אישי של 20 דק + שאלת אלגוריתם שמוגדרת קלה ואם עוברים את ה20 דק, ממשיכים למבחן טכני של שעה וחצי
שאלות מתוך הראיון
במבחן הבית ניתנה שאלה של מימוש word ladder - מקבלים נתיב לקובץ עם מילים, מילת התחלה ומילת סוף, צריך להוציא פלט של רשימה שמכילה מילים עם הבדל של אות אחת ביניהן, כך שהראשונה היא מילת ההתחלה והאחרונה מילת הסוף. ישנם מקרי קצה שדורשים התייחסות מיוחדת.
מבחן בית ראשוני לתפקיד סטודנט לפיתוח (software dev student)
שאלות מתוך הראיון
בהינתן לוח שחמט 5x5 ומשבצות מסויימות חסומות (מספר השבצות החסומות משתנה) בלוח, יש לבדוק האם ניתן להציב בלוח 6 מלכות בלי שיאיימו אחת על השניה.
המשבצות החסומות באות לידי ביטוי בכך שאם יש 2 מלכות בשורה אחת ובינהן קיימת משבצת חסומה, אזי הן לא מאיימות אחת על השניה.
I interviewed for a Frontend Developer position specializing in React. The process started with an email from an HR recruiter to schedule a screening call. The screening call was very pleasant, and we arranged a 30-minute Zoom meeting with the software architect. During this meeting, we discussed my experience, the company's goals, and the role itself.
A few days later, I was informed that they wanted to proceed with a task. They asked for my availability and provided a task that would take approximately three hours to complete. The task was well-designed and fit within the given timeframe.
After submitting the task, I received another call from HR to schedule a follow-up meeting with the software architect and another team leader. In this meeting, we reviewed the task I had completed and discussed software architecture, work processes like pull requests and unit testing, as well as some soft skills questions.
שאלות מתוך הראיון
Setting up a React project with several pages and components
- ראיון high level עם ראש צוות. שאלה טכנית קלה בפסודו קוד.
- משימת בית מאד ארוכה ואחריה review
הסבר על החברה, מעבר על קורות חיים.
המראיין היה מאד נעים. היה אי תאימות בין הצורה שבה הHR הציגה את המשרה/החברה לבין איך שהמראיין הציג.
המשימת בית חריגה מאד בהיקפה.
שאלות מתוך הראיון
- בראיון: משימה קלה של מעבר על רשימה וסכימת אביריה עד חסם מסוים.
- מטלת בית: מימוש מלא של אלגוריתם external sort עבור קובץ CSV גדול עם מגבלת מקום של C שורות בזיכרון. מימוש ע"י קוד מקבלי, input validation, unit tests.